Driving License Scooter Laws

Based on the state you live in, you may not need a special driving license to drive scooters. New York, for instance has scooters classified in accordance with their maximum speed, and requires registration, prowadzenie Skutera license and insurance.

In Alaska you will require an endorsement for motorcycles on your driver's licence or a separate motorcycle license to drive mopeds or scooters.

Mopeds

For those who reside in urban areas, a driving license scooter is an enjoyable and efficient method to travel around. These vehicles are more eco green and more convenient to park than a car. They are also more dangerous if not handled properly. Although the rules for mopeds may differ slightly from state to state, most are considered to be a kind of motorcycle and have similar laws in place.

Pennsylvania defines a moped to be a two-wheeled automobile with pedals that can be operated by feet for propulsion and an engine no larger than 50 cc. In addition the vehicle should be capable of travelling at a maximum speed of 30 mph on level ground. Anyone operating a moped has to wear a helmet at all times and the vehicle has to be registered, insured, and checked.

In Michigan the state of Michigan, it defines mopeds as motor-driven bikes that are not built to transport passengers. They are not required to be registered or titled, but drivers must obtain a valid driver's license or moped permit in order to drive on public roadways. The state also requires that all moped riders have insurance for liability.

Montana as well as Pennsylvania, classifies mopeds as being a type of motorcycle and requires the driver to have a Class M or MJ (motorcycle) license to operate mopeds. The state also requires that motorists of mopeds wear helmets and eye protection. The registration procedure for mopeds is the same as for regular motorcycles. All owners must register them and show proof of insurance to be able to drive on roads that are public.

Other states treat mopeds and scooters in a similar manner and require that they are registered, titled and insured, as well as having a valid driver's licence or moped license to operate on public roads. Different states might have different definitions for these types of vehicles and require a certain level of education to operate them. It is crucial to inquire with your local department of transportation before purchasing mopeds.

Scooters

Scooters are self-propelled vehicles with two wheels designed for personal transportation. They are equipped with a body that conceals the majority of the mechanicals. They typically include some storage like an integrated seat or a front leg shield. They also come in various engines and power configurations ranging from 50cc models that have one cylinder up to twin cylinder scooters with 850cc. Scooters usually have chains, but they can also be driven with a direct drive. They can be powered by gasoline, natural gas or battery-powered electric motors. Most are made with cast aluminum or pressed steel alloy wheels, and many are able to swap front and rear tires. There are a myriad of options when it comes to braking systems. These include mechanical disc brakes, drum brakes, and electronic brakes or regenerative ones.

In New York, a moped or scooter can be operated without a license so provided that it meets certain specifications. These requirements include pedals that are made to be used by humans for propulsion and a floorboard made to be sat on while operating the vehicle. They also require an engine that is not larger than 50cc and not more than two horsepower for brakes. Mopeds and scooters are only permitted to be used on roads with the speed limit of not exceeding 30 mph.

If the engine of your scooter is larger than 50cc, or produces 2 brake horsepower, it will be classified as motorbike. You will need to have it titled, licensed and registered, and adhere to the same rules as if you were driving a car. You will also need to wear a helmet when driving on public roads.

In certain states, such as Connecticut prawo jazdy na motor scooters are regarded as mopeds, and must be registered and registered and. They can only be driven on roads with an upper limit of 30 mph or less. They are not allowed to be driven on sidewalks or bicycle lanes. They also require helmets for riders under 18. In addition, mopeds and scooters need to be parked upright in order to ensure that sidewalks are clear for pedestrians.

Motorcycles

In a number of states, motorized vehicles that reach a top speed of 30 mph or more on level ground, and don't have pedals to assist in propulsion, are classified as motorcycles, and kursy Motocyklowe A1 are required to be titled and insured. Motorized bicycles should also be treated in the same way as motorcycles. Both kinds of vehicles require that users wear eye protection and a helmet. In Georgia for instance, all operators and riders of motorized bicycles, Kurs Motocyklowy A1 mopeds, and motorized bikes must wear a helmet in order to be legally on the road.

The process of getting an motorcycle license is generally similar to the process for getting the regular driver's license and usually requires passing a written test at your local Driver License Examination Station and completing an on-cycle driving skills test. After passing both tests, you will be allowed to take the motorcycle road test with a certified examiner on an off-street test.

Bring your helmet, motorcycle and eye protection to the road-test. After passing the road test, you will be issued a motorized bike license. In most cases, you must also register your motorcycle and pay a small fee for registration.

Motorcycles are considered to be more dangerous than mopeds. They therefore require a higher age for licensing and stricter operating rules. In New Mexico, for example you must be 16 years old to operate motorbikes. You must also pass a safety class, a rider's exam, and a riding test.

A helmet is also required if you are riding a motorcycle on public property, including private property. You must also have insurance for liability on your vehicle.

If you want to operate your motorized scooter on the highways, you will need a class M motorcycle license. This license is valid for all vehicles with motors of 50cc or more. However, you will still need to pass an understanding and driving skills test to be able to get an official motorcycle license. In addition, you will need to register your motorcycle and pay the small fee for registration and kurs motocyklowy a1 inspection.

Licensing

The laws about who can operate what type of scooter in New York City are not specific, and this could result in confusion and legal issues. A knowledgeable lawyer can help clarify the law and help people avoid problems with their city and state licensing requirements for scooters.

In Massachusetts mopeds, motorized scooters that are used on public roadways need to be registered, titled and have license plates. The vehicles are required to be insured for a minimum of $15,000 per person, and the amount is $30,000 per accident. The MA RMV also requires that anyone who is younger than 16 years old wear a helmet.

Some states have stricter requirements for scooters that are used for leisure. In New Mexico, for example, anyone who operates the scooter with pedals and is able to travel greater than 20 mph over flat ground must have a valid driver's licence. All passengers and operators must wear helmets. In some states, pytania egzaminacyjne na prawo jazdy a1 like Pennsylvania the scooter that falls between moped and motorcycle rules is deemed to be to be a "motor-driven cycle." To be considered a motor-driven cycle motor, the motor must have less than 50 ccs, and produce no more than 2 horsepower for Jazda Motocyklem brakes. The vehicle must also be inspected and you need to obtain a Class M license to operate it on the road.

The majority of people will only think about the use of a scooter when it is street legal. In New York, that means it can only be operated on streets and bike lanes. It is not allowed to drive on a street or sidewalk. It must be driven in the correct lane, and all traffic laws must be obeyed. For example, it cannot traverse solid white lines, or pass vehicles on the right.
